> Problem: I'd like to easily be able to specify to a query
> "disable_other_eagerloads", in a manner similar to
> enable_eagerloads(False), except it only affects relationships not
> specifically joined/subquery loaded for that query.

You turn them off with the lazyload() option.    Guessing you want this 
generically.  You'd build a function that iterates through 
mapper.get_properties() for each entity in the Query, checks each 
MapperProperty with isinstance(x, RelationshipProperty), checks lazy=False, 
then adds it to a list.    Output is a collection of lazyload() options you 
send to options:

query.options(*lazyload_all_except("x", "y"))

Keep in mind this doesn't have to traverse deeply, only on the attributes that 
are immediately present.

A more comprehensive way would be to subclass MapperOption and have it actually 
look and see what joinedloads are already present, though that requires knowing 
about the conventions that the loader options use within the query._attributes 
dictionary.     It also would have to be the last thing you call on options.   
A feature might look like that.  Or it would put in some other symbol into 
query._attributes that everyone needs to check.      compare to 
http://www.sqlalchemy.org/trac/ticket/1418 .
